An Experiential Workshop for Self-Nurturing, Calm and Presence with Dr Susan McGarvie

Tuesday 9 July 2024
09:00-14:00
R300 per person

Bring and share lunch. Tea, coffee and water will be available.

Peter Bennett Community Centre
Two Rivers Place, Oettle Street, Kenton on Sea

Join us for an experiential mindfulness workshop designed to help you find peace and presence in the midst of life's chaos. Through guided meditation, mindful movement, and interactive exercises, you'll discover techniques to reduce stress, enhance emotional well-being, and cultivate a deeper connection with yourself and the world around you. This hands-on workshop is perfect for beginners and experienced practitioners alike, offering practical tools to integrate mindfulness into your daily routine.

Meet Dr Susan McGarvie.

Susan is a local girl who grew up on a farm near Kenton. After spending some time away, she's circled back to her roots, and now offers mindfulness-based therapeutic coaching and counselling both in-person [in Kenton] and online.

Susan's background includes degrees in nursing, business management, palliative care, and psychology, alongside decades of experience in healthcare, non-profits, and academia. Her evidence-based practice integrates positive psychology, mindfulness, coaching and adult learning principles and approaches.
